Relief Commr (M) reviews arrangements for Maha Shivratri Festival

JAMMU: A meeting was held today under the chairmanship of Dr. Arvind Karwani, Relief and Rehabilitation (M) J&K to review the necessary arrangements for the Annual Maha Shivratri Festival, falling on 07/08th of March 2024.

The officers from Food Civil Supplies & Consumer Affairs (FCS&CA), Fisheries, Floriculture, Horticulture, Sheep Husbandry, Jal Shakti, Jammu Municipal Corporation and representatives from District Administration attended the meeting.

The chair highlighted the importance of the Maha Shivratri Festival, particularly for the Kashmiri Pandit community and requested the District Administration to constitute checking squads to monitor the quality and the rates of essential commodities like Flowers, Pooja items, Mutton, Fish, Vegetables, Milk products etc.

The Floriculture Department assured the supply of flowers especially Bael/Bael leaves and Marigold to all the migrant camps viz. Jagti, Muthi, Purkhoo and Nagrota and Non Camps areas where Kashmiri Pandits have a sizeable population viz Durga Nagar, Roop Nagar, Janipur Colony, Anand Nagar, Bohri, Gangyal, Subash Nagar, Muthi, Udhaywala, Talab Tillo etc. during the festival days.

The Department of Horticulture assured supply of good quality walnuts, green vegetables, especially Nadru, etc in all the migrant camps and non-camps areas during the festival days at approved rates.

The Department of FCS&CA assured smooth supply of all quality food items in camps and non-camp areas.

The Jammu Municipal Corporation assured arrangements of cleanliness in the areas falling within the municipal limits.

The Sheep Husbandry Department, Jammu assured an adequate supply of mutton at reasonable rates in close coordination with Jammu Municipal Corporation.

The Department of Fisheries assured the supply of adequate quantities of fish in all the migrant camps and prominent non-camps areas.

The participants assured that all the necessary arrangements will be in place well in advance to facilitate the smooth celebration of the Maha Shivratri festival.

Chief Engineer, JPDCL and Chief Engineer, PHE Department, were requested to ensure uninterrupted electricity and water supply in all the migrant camps and non-camps areas during the festival days
